Overview
The Test Engineer is responsible for testing new systems within a dedicated testing area as well as printed circuit boards (PCB) prior to their installation.
Responsibilities- Bench test printed circuit boards using an oscilloscope and multimeter, recording values within defined tolerances
- Pre-test inspections to confirm new equipment is safe to energise
- Test new equipment and record values within defined tolerances
- Troubleshooting of new equipment when measured values are outside of the specified tolerance
- Other assignments as designated by the Production Manager
- Electrical/Electronic qualification
- You will have experience of testing/fault finding electronic/electrical circuits and can follow a wiring diagram
- Troubleshoot and repair printed circuit boards down to component level
- Working with 3 phase power and high voltage batteries
- You work well both independently and within a team. You enjoy the challenge of working under pressure and to deadlines
- Organised, methodical approach with good problem-solving skills
- Good written and spoken English
- Good understanding of Word, Excel & Outlook
- You understand Electrical Safety and WEEE regulations

Powervamp Limited is a UK based company based in the heart of Bedfordshire. Our company forms part of the TLD group of companies. TLD is a French company (part of the Alvest group) operating in an international environment, a leader in the design, assembly, distribution, and after-sales service of airport ground support equipment (GSE). Our products are used in airports around the world.
We develop innovative products (autonomous, hybrid, electric, and sustainable vehicles) and contribute to reducing the environmental footprint of the aviation industry. To actively face and participate in environmental challenges, TLD is committed:
We are members of the 'Solar Impulse' foundation and the United Nations 'Global Compact' initiative, which aims to promote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R).
